The costs of X rays.

J A Stilwell.   

Abstract

A costing system for radiology departments has been developed which runs on a micro-computer and can produce, for about two days' clerical work, a list of average costs for every type of X ray performed in a department. All costs, including capital and radiologists' time, are covered and the system could be used in the development of performance indicators. An example run, in a general hospital in the West Midlands, is given.
